Description The College of Education, Leadership Studies, and Counseling at the University of Lynchburg invites applications for a full-time, tenure-track faculty position in Counseling Education in School Counseling. This appointment will begin July 1, 2024.
We seek a colleague who is committed to excellence in teaching, supervision, and the continuous improvement of our program. We are seeking candidates with experience and knowledge in counseling education with an emphasis in school counseling with experience in K-12 public school settings.
